About Me
I was born and raised in Los Angeles and received my Bachelor of Science Degree from the University of California at Los Angeles. I continued my studies in Chicago at Loyola University Stritch School of Medicine in 1993. I began my OB/GYN residency at Illinois Masonic Medical Center in Chicago and moved back to California to complete my training at Kaiser Foundation Hospital in Oakland.
As a resident, I found great satisfaction in teaching fellow residents and medical students. Now as a staff physician at Kaiser, I teach OB/GYN in Labor and Delivery as well as in the operating room. I consistently receive top marks as a resident educator. I am a Fellow of the American College of Obstetrics and Gynecology and am currently the Communication Consultant and the Service Chairman for the Department of OB/GYN.
